A soft cotton infinity scarf made in Nepal at a WFTO (World Fair Trade Organisation) factory, which provides work and training opportunities for marginalised communities. This pink tie-dye scarf is made from super soft cotton jersey and can be wrapped once or twice round the neck.

This infinity scarf is so versatile; it’s made from a tube of fabric and is the perfect holiday item, doubling as a beach cover-up, skirt or even a top.

Please note this item is hand printed and any imperfections are part of the unique nature of our products.

  • Made in a Fair Trade factory

  • Pink and white tie-dye print

  • Cotton jersey

  • Approx 72cm by 68cm when flat

  • Hand wash cold

Get dressed in Jenerous’ ethical and sustainable clothing and know you’re supporting a brand that puts people above profit, changing lives for the better. 

In keeping with their name, Jenerous is all about giving back and supports people in India through the production of their clothes. 

Every sale helps fund training and work opportunities for people in their supply chain as well as supporting the wider communities through charity donations. The aim is to empower people from low socio-economic backgrounds – especially women. 

Ensuring respect, positive working conditions and fair pay for those in their supply chain is paramount for Jenerous. All their suppliers are carefully selected for their commitment to fair trade principles and active role in creating social change. 

From scarves to tops and dresses, the Jenerous collection is as beautiful as it is ethical. Made up of sustainable fabrics such as organic cotton, pieces feature patterns created by hand using Indian artisan block printing. 

The brand is also savvy when it comes to waste-saving techniques, like using up leftover fabric to create their matching mini-me girls dresses.
